WebAug 12, 2024 · #1 - Lowering the Policy Rate and Keeping it Low First, the Fed’s monetary policymaking body—the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C)—quickly lowered the target range for the federal funds rate. The federal funds rate, which serves as the FOMC’s policy interest rate, is the rate banks charge each other for overnight loans. Web1 day ago · Governor Christopher J. Waller.
